The Preschool Box

The Preschool Box is a monthly subscription full of preschool activities and a prepared preschool curriculum delivered straight to your door. Each box is full of monthly activities that encourage learning, reading and creativity in children ages 3-6! The box contains detailed instructions for parents to know exactly what to do each day with their child, for each activity. Most of the activities are pre-cut, stored together, and come with everything you need to complete the activity. The activities are creative and hands on which keeps kids engaged and enjoying learning. The curriculum is created by the team with learning and teaching experience, and is easy for parents to follow and kids to have fun!
